Swing Rope/Personnel Transfer Training

Objective: The Swing Rope/Personnel Transfer Training aims to provide participants with the knowledge, skills, and safety protocols required for safe and efficient personnel transfer using swing ropes or other designated transfer methods in maritime and offshore environments.

Summary: This training program focuses on teaching individuals the proper techniques, safety measures, and equipment usage for personnel transfer between vessels, platforms, or structures using swing ropes or other transfer methods commonly employed in maritime settings.

Course Topics: The curriculum for Swing Rope/Personnel Transfer Training typically includes:

  • Introduction to swing rope/personnel transfer methods

  • Safety regulations and guidelines for personnel transfer

  • Equipment overview and usage for safe transfers

  • Proper techniques for personnel transfer

  • Risk assessment and hazard identification

  • Emergency procedures and rescue protocols

  • Practical exercises and hands-on training (if applicable)

Who Should Attend: This course is essential for personnel working in maritime industries, offshore platforms, or vessels where swing rope or other personnel transfer methods are utilized. It is beneficial for crew members, offshore personnel, marine pilots, and anyone involved in personnel transfer operations.
